The Health Benefits of Fenugreek
Fenugreek is a spice that is used a lot when making curries and is basic ingredient of five-spice powder and curry powders.
But, as well as adding flavor to curries, fenugreek also has a variety of medicinal applications.
A quick search of the Internet shows that fenugreek is used to treat high cholesterol, diabetes, indigestion, inflammation, skin disorders, menstrual aches and pains, ulcers, colds and sore throats.
In addition, fenugreek has been used to induce labour and stimulate breast milk production.
Other, non-medicinal, uses of fenugreek include its use for weight control and for breast enlargements.
You should always talk to your doctor before starting to use a new medicine and taking fenugreek is no exception. There are warnings that pregnant women should not use fenugreek. Your doctor will have the latest information available.
But using fenugreek in your curries is probably OK, as well as being tasty.
